And just wait until some dimwit's radio is either lost or stolen, or leaves the battery off long enough for the encryption key to be erased. Then all the radios (the entire fleet) have to be rekeyed. They don't think about that little wrinkle.

Even with over-the-air-rekeying (OTAR), encryption key management is a pain in the butt.

That being said, there is no guarantee they'll go with encryption; it does cost quite a bit of extra money, and I suspect the preference in smaller departments would be to get new radios into everyone's hands rather than a few with encryption.
